Troubleshooting Common Issues with Realtek Audio Driver on Windows 10

If you are experiencing issues with your Realtek audio driver on Windows 10, it can be frustrating and disruptive to your work or entertainment. However, there are common problems that users encounter with the Realtek audio driver, and there are troubleshooting steps you can take to resolve these issues. Below are some common issues and their corresponding solutions:

1. No sound or audio output from the speakers:
– Check for muted or low volume settings on your computer and the speakers themselves.
– Ensure that the audio driver is up to date by visiting the Realtek website or using a driver update tool.
– Verify that the speakers are connected properly to the computer and that all cables are secure.

2. Audio distortion or crackling sounds:
– Update the audio driver to the latest version from the Realtek website.
– Check for any physical damage to the speakers or audio cables that may be causing the distortion.
– Adjust the audio settings in the Realtek control panel to see if the issue persists.

How to Update and Reinstall Realtek Audio Driver on Windows 10

Updating and reinstalling Realtek audio driver on Windows 10 is essential to ensure that your audio system functions properly. Whether you are experiencing audio issues or simply want to ensure that you have the latest driver version, this guide will walk you through the process step by step.

Updating Realtek Audio Driver:

  • Open Device Manager by right-clicking on the Start button and selecting it from the menu.
  • Expand the “Sound, video, and game controllers” category, and right-click on “Realtek High Definition Audio”.
  • Select “Update driver” and choose the option to search automatically for updated driver software.
  • Follow the on-screen instructions to complete the update process.

Reinstalling Realtek Audio Driver:

  • To reinstall the driver, first, uninstall the existing Realtek High Definition Audio driver from the Device Manager.
  • Once uninstalled, restart your computer and download the latest driver from the Realtek website.
  • Install the downloaded driver and restart your computer to complete the process.

Q&A

Q: What is Realtek audio driver and its compatibility with Windows 10?
A: Realtek audio driver is a software component that enables communication between the operating system and the audio hardware in a computer. It is compatible with Windows 10 and is a common choice for many PC manufacturers.

Q: Why is it important to have the correct Realtek audio driver for Windows 10?
A: Having the correct Realtek audio driver ensures that the audio hardware on your computer can function properly and that you can enjoy high-quality sound output.

Q: How can I update the Realtek audio driver on Windows 10?
A: You can update the Realtek audio driver in Windows 10 by visiting the manufacturer’s website and downloading the latest driver version for your specific hardware. You can also use the Device Manager in Windows to update the driver automatically.

Q: Are there any common issues with Realtek audio driver on Windows 10?
A: Some common issues with Realtek audio driver on Windows 10 include sound distortion, no sound output, or compatibility problems with certain applications. These issues can often be resolved by updating the driver to the latest version.

Q: Can I uninstall the Realtek audio driver from Windows 10?
A: While it is possible to uninstall the Realtek audio driver from Windows 10, it is not recommended unless you have a specific reason to do so. Removing the driver can cause your audio hardware to stop functioning properly.
